1. A circumferential ablation device assembly for ablating a circumferential lesion in a body space wall which circumscribes at least a portion of a body space, comprising:

  • an elongate body with a proximal end portion, a distal end portion and a longitudinal axis that extends between the proximal and distal end portions;

    an expandable member located in the region of the distal end portion and having a working length along the longitudinal axis which is adjustable between a radially collapsed position and a radially expanded position, the working length having a larger outer diameter when in the radially expanded position than when in the radially collapsed position;

    an expansion actuator which is coupled to the expandable member and which is adapted to adjust the expandable member from the radially collapsed position to the radially expanded position; and

    a circumferential ablation element that includes an equatorial band which circumscribes at least a portion of an outer surface of the working length of the expandable member when in the radially expanded position, the equatorial band having an equatorial band width along the longitudinal axis which is shorter than the working length, the circumferential ablation element being adapted to ablate a circumferential region of tissue adjacent to the equatorial band and along the body space wall when the circumferential ablation element is coupled to and actuated by an ablation actuator.
